There’s No Place Like Home
Our daily plans never block time for troubles or disasters. That’s why it makes good sense to plan for the unexpected with a State Farm homeowners policy. Home insurance protects more than just your home's structure. It protects both your home and the things inside it. In the event of vandalism or a tornado, you might have damage to the items in your home on top of damage to the structure itself. If your belongings are not insured, you might not be able to replace your valuables. Some of the things you own can be protected from theft or loss outside of your home, like if your car is stolen with your computer inside it or your bicycle is stolen from work.
